Now on their third album, Norway's Katzenjammer return to their legions of cult followers with yet another dizzying blend of rock, folk, blues and pop - masterfully crafted with the excess of 30 instruments they can play between them. They’re all drummers, they can all play the banjo, or the trashcans, the kazoo, the celeste or the washboard, but that's just the start.
That's not to say there's anything self-indulgent about Katzenjammer. Once described by radio legend Steve Lamacq as "the best gig of my time at Glastonbury", these four talented woman destroy the boundaries of genre to create an all-encompassing and all-consuming celebration of song.
"We have our own world in Katzenjammer," says Solveig Heilo. "We never follow the rules, or try to be commercial when we write music. We’ve always done what we feel like and went with our hearts. It’s not a parallel to getting imprisoned but we’re together in this bubble where the rules are quite different to the rest of the world. That’s what Rockland is a symbol is for."
